How Common Is The Last Name Crae?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 1,755,741st most frequent surname on a worldwide basis, held by approximately 1 in 66,858,219 people. This last name is predominantly found in Asia, where 61 percent of Crae are found; 61 percent are found in Southeast Asia and 50 percent are found in Khmer-Asia. Crae is also the 904,892nd most frequently held first name globally, borne by 108 people.

Crae is most numerous in Cambodia, where it is borne by 54 people, or 1 in 286,799. In Cambodia it is primarily concentrated in: Mondulkiri Province, where 67 percent live, Phnom Penh, where 20 percent live and Kampong Cham Province, where 4 percent live. Other than Cambodia Crae is found in 9 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 23 percent live and Indonesia, where 11 percent live.

Crae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The frequency of Crae has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name rose 625 percent between 1880 and 2014; in Scotland it decreased 37 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in England it rose 150 percent between 1881 and 2014.
